Publisher's Synopsis

Britain's most articulate singer-songwriter remains a complex individual whose lyrics opt for realism, opinion, waspish wit, irony, asexuality, melancholy and love. In this biography, Morrissey's friends and the members of his entourage speak frankly to David Bret to produce a fascinating study of the iconic star.
